/linux-4.4.14/net/mac80211/ |
H A D | aes_gcm.c | 26 struct aead_request *aead_req = (void *)aead_req_data; ieee80211_aes_gcm_encrypt() local 28 memset(aead_req, 0, sizeof(aead_req_data)); ieee80211_aes_gcm_encrypt() 35 aead_request_set_tfm(aead_req, tfm); ieee80211_aes_gcm_encrypt() 36 aead_request_set_crypt(aead_req, sg, sg, data_len, j_0); ieee80211_aes_gcm_encrypt() 37 aead_request_set_ad(aead_req, sg[0].length); ieee80211_aes_gcm_encrypt() 39 crypto_aead_encrypt(aead_req); ieee80211_aes_gcm_encrypt() 49 struct aead_request *aead_req = (void *)aead_req_data; ieee80211_aes_gcm_decrypt() local 54 memset(aead_req, 0, sizeof(aead_req_data)); ieee80211_aes_gcm_decrypt() 61 aead_request_set_tfm(aead_req, tfm); ieee80211_aes_gcm_decrypt() 62 aead_request_set_crypt(aead_req, sg, sg, ieee80211_aes_gcm_decrypt() 64 aead_request_set_ad(aead_req, sg[0].length); ieee80211_aes_gcm_decrypt() 66 return crypto_aead_decrypt(aead_req); ieee80211_aes_gcm_decrypt()
|
H A D | aes_ccm.c | 30 struct aead_request *aead_req = (void *) aead_req_data; ieee80211_aes_ccm_encrypt() local 32 memset(aead_req, 0, sizeof(aead_req_data)); ieee80211_aes_ccm_encrypt() 39 aead_request_set_tfm(aead_req, tfm); ieee80211_aes_ccm_encrypt() 40 aead_request_set_crypt(aead_req, sg, sg, data_len, b_0); ieee80211_aes_ccm_encrypt() 41 aead_request_set_ad(aead_req, sg[0].length); ieee80211_aes_ccm_encrypt() 43 crypto_aead_encrypt(aead_req); ieee80211_aes_ccm_encrypt() 54 struct aead_request *aead_req = (void *) aead_req_data; ieee80211_aes_ccm_decrypt() local 59 memset(aead_req, 0, sizeof(aead_req_data)); ieee80211_aes_ccm_decrypt() 66 aead_request_set_tfm(aead_req, tfm); ieee80211_aes_ccm_decrypt() 67 aead_request_set_crypt(aead_req, sg, sg, data_len + mic_len, b_0); ieee80211_aes_ccm_decrypt() 68 aead_request_set_ad(aead_req, sg[0].length); ieee80211_aes_ccm_decrypt() 70 return crypto_aead_decrypt(aead_req); ieee80211_aes_ccm_decrypt()
|
H A D | aes_gmac.c | 31 struct aead_request *aead_req = (void *)aead_req_data; ieee80211_aes_gmac() local 37 memset(aead_req, 0, sizeof(aead_req_data)); ieee80211_aes_gmac() 50 aead_request_set_tfm(aead_req, tfm); ieee80211_aes_gmac() 51 aead_request_set_crypt(aead_req, sg, sg, 0, iv); ieee80211_aes_gmac() 52 aead_request_set_ad(aead_req, AAD_LEN + data_len); ieee80211_aes_gmac() 54 crypto_aead_encrypt(aead_req); ieee80211_aes_gmac()
|
/linux-4.4.14/crypto/ |
H A D | algif_aead.c | 54 struct aead_request aead_req; member in struct:aead_ctx 73 unsigned as = crypto_aead_authsize(crypto_aead_reqtfm(&ctx->aead_req)); aead_sufficient_data() 174 crypto_aead_ivsize(crypto_aead_reqtfm(&ctx->aead_req)); aead_sendmsg() 357 unsigned as = crypto_aead_authsize(crypto_aead_reqtfm(&ctx->aead_req)); aead_recvmsg() 444 aead_request_set_crypt(&ctx->aead_req, sgl->sg, ctx->rsgl[0].sg, aead_recvmsg() 446 aead_request_set_ad(&ctx->aead_req, ctx->aead_assoclen); aead_recvmsg() 449 crypto_aead_encrypt(&ctx->aead_req) : aead_recvmsg() 450 crypto_aead_decrypt(&ctx->aead_req), aead_recvmsg() 541 crypto_aead_reqtfm(&ctx->aead_req)); aead_sock_destruct() 580 aead_request_set_tfm(&ctx->aead_req, private); aead_accept_parent() 581 aead_request_set_callback(&ctx->aead_req, CRYPTO_TFM_REQ_MAY_BACKLOG, aead_accept_parent()
|
/linux-4.4.14/drivers/crypto/qat/qat_common/ |
H A D | qat_crypto.h | 85 struct aead_request *aead_req; member in union:qat_crypto_request::__anon3890
|
H A D | qat_algs.c | 780 struct aead_request *areq = qat_req->aead_req; qat_aead_alg_callback() 833 qat_req->aead_req = areq; qat_alg_aead_dec() 875 qat_req->aead_req = areq; qat_alg_aead_enc()
|
/linux-4.4.14/drivers/crypto/ |
H A D | picoxcell_crypto.c | 501 static int spacc_aead_need_fallback(struct aead_request *aead_req) spacc_aead_need_fallback() argument 503 struct crypto_aead *aead = crypto_aead_reqtfm(aead_req); spacc_aead_need_fallback() 547 struct aead_request *aead_req = spacc_aead_submit() local 549 struct crypto_aead *aead = crypto_aead_reqtfm(aead_req); spacc_aead_submit() 559 ctx->cipher_key_len, aead_req->iv, crypto_aead_ivsize(aead), spacc_aead_submit() 567 assoc_len = aead_req->assoclen; spacc_aead_submit() 568 proc_len = aead_req->cryptlen + assoc_len; spacc_aead_submit()
|
H A D | ixp4xx_crypto.c | 146 struct aead_request *aead_req; member in union:crypt_ctl::__anon3845 348 struct aead_request *req = crypt->data.aead_req; finish_scattered_hmac() 374 struct aead_request *req = crypt->data.aead_req; one_packet() 1023 crypt->data.aead_req = req; aead_perform()
|